In small motors, the influence from the U/f characteristic on efficiency is marginal. However, in motors from 11 kW and up, the advantages are significant.
In general, the switching frequency does not affect the efficiency of small motors. Motors from 11 kW and up have their efficiency improved (1-2%). This
is because the sine shape of the motor current is almost perfect at high switching frequency.

8.4 Acoustic Noise
The acoustic noise from the frequency converter comes from three sources:
1. DC intermediate circuit coils.
2. Integral fan.
3. RFI filter choke.
The typical values measured at a distance of 1 m from the unit:
Enclosure
At reduced fan speed (50%) [dBA] *** Full fan speed [dBA]
A2 51 60
A3 51 60
A5 54 63
B1 61 67
B2 58 70
B3 59.4 70.5
B4 53 62.8
C1 52 62
C2 55 65
C3 56.4 67.3
C4 --
D1/D3 74 76
D2/D4 73 74
E1/E2* 73 74
** 82 83
F1/F2/F3/F4 78 80
* 315 kW, 380-480 VAC and 450-500 kW, 525-690 VAC only!
** Remaining E1/E2 power sizes.
*** For D, E and F sizes, reduced fan speed is at 87%, measured at 200 V.
8.5 Peak Voltage on Motor
When a transistor in the inverter bridge switches, the voltage across the motor increases by a du/dt ratio depending on:
- the motor cable (type, cross-section, length screened or unscreened)
- inductance
The natural induction causes an overshoot U
PEAK
in the motor voltage before it stabilizes itself at a level depending on the voltage in the intermediate
circuit. The rise time and the peak voltage U
PEAK
affect the service life of the motor. If the peak voltage is too high, especially motors without phase coil
insulation are affected. If the motor cable is short (a few metres), the rise time and peak voltage are lower.
If the motor cable is long (100 m), the rise time and peak voltage increases.
In motors without phase insulation paper or other insulation reinforcement suitable for operation with voltage supply (such as a frequency converter),
fit a sine-wave filter on the output of the frequency converter.
